With enthusiasm and a positive spirit, another successful year of the innovative Noutree healthy eating program has concluded at E. Mandoulides Schools. This program, aimed at students of all grade levels, focuses on raising awareness about the importance of proper, balanced nutrition and seeks to cultivate healthy eating habits in children of all ages.
As the rates of childhood obesity have increased alarmingly in our country, modern schools are called upon to engage both students and parents on the topic of nutrition. In this context, during the past school year, E. Mandoulides Schools implemented the Noutree program, combining modern technology with expert advice and guidelines from renowned nutritionists. Additionally, the program offered parents access not only to the products their children consumed at school but also to information about their nutritional value and how well they meet their children’s dietary needs.
